ABSTRACT:
The invention comprises a hook attachment having a frame with a plurality of hooks pivotally mounted to the frame. The attachment has a engaging flange and eyelets for receiving the attaching flange and engaging pins, respectively on the front of the arms of a front end loader. The attachment has an attaching flange and engaging pins mounted on the front of the frame of the attachment for engaging an attaching flange and eyelets on the rear of a bucket, whereby the hook attachment may be attached directly to the front of a front end loader and used alone with the front end loader, or the attaching flange and engaging pins on the front of the frame of the locking attachment may engage the attaching flange and eyelets on the rear of the bucket to attach the bucket to the flange of the hook attachment so that the hook attachment and bucket may be used together on the front end loader.
